Calheta de São Miguel - the afternoon of the first day (cont.) - the 21st of April 2012



(...)

I was beginning to get worried because I felt we wouldn't have enough time to call onto all the children apart from not having met some of the ones we needed to invite for the birthday party, and although I didn't show my concern to my "adventure companions" I had already begun to work out another "strategy".



The next girl we came across was Ana Bina, who was not only surprised to realise she had "another godmother" but also with the contagious enthusiasm displayed by Henriqueta (mother of  the new godmother), as she literally covered her in presents.























We had to "shorten" the distance so we ended up following the girls up and down rather difficult paths where quite a few children and animals were to be seen ...
















Eveline Natalina was next. She also had already received her birthday presents, so this time she got some photos and a letter from her "godmother" Bell, as well as the oficial invitation for the birthday party the following day.







Then we called in at the sisters Sonia (below) and Jessica  (underneath) to hand them out some presents sent by their "godmothers" (Telma and Dina respectively). In the case of Sonia some extra birthday presents and in Jessica's a new outfit for the birthday party the following  day. Although Jessica didn't show the same "enthusiasm" as Sonia's I confirmed she had loved it but didn't know how to react to "happiness".





 


 




Liliane Rosy  was the next one to get the presents her "godmother" Teresa sent her, as well as the official invitation for the birthday party. She looked us deep in the eyes whilst holding her presents, having chosen to unwrap them on her own.







We then moved on to try to locate Eduardo, Kevin, Veinilson and Justina but it was in vain, so we hurried towards Juliza's as the sun was starting to go dow ... and as in Africa it does go down abruptly, we hadn't much time left.



A little girl approached me whilst her mother kept on saying she really liked me, though I had the distinct impression of never having seen her ...but the truth is that by this time I was too tired to even be able to think back.



 





I sighted Juliza among a group of women and children and she looked rather surprised and shocked to see me but soon came running towards us. She got the doll she had asked her "godmother" Isabel Mégre for and against all odds  went silent, even when it came to "voice" a message, but her beautiful smile lit her whole face when she finally got hold of the doll.
